._progmem_far (together with PFSTR macro and the xxx_PF() functions) is
intended to provide a relatively easy and transparent relief from a pressure on
the lower 64k FLASH by moving mainly strings to above the .data initialisers.
._progmem_segment1 etc: "The purpose of "segmented" usage is to allow for
faster and more comfortable address calculation, if we know beforehand that we
can fit all FLASH data into a 64k "segment", (segment1 is 0x10000-0x1FFFF,
segment2 is 0x20000-0x2FFFF, segment3 is 0x30000-0x3FFFF). To access them, we
still need the pgm_read_xxx_far() (and xxx_PF()) family, but we can use the
"native" pointer mechanism and then add the segment address."
